Hello coaches, fans, and members of the media!

We at the SimNFL headquarters have an important announcement to make regarding the home of the 2023 SimNFL Super Bowl.

Originally, we definitely had a lucrative and exciting deal to host this year's Super Bowl at great stadium with amazing amenities that would have allowed all staff, friends, and family members to stay for free. Unfortunately, due to some very risky options trading by the owners of this stadium, they are now at risk of defaulting on their loans, so we need urgently find a new location to host the Super Bowl.

We would also like to address the popular and INCORRECT rumors. Contrary to what the media is reporting, the SimNFL staff did NOT spend an exorbitant amount of time and money developing a ChatGPT competitor for the purposes of simulating the viability of 4th and long fullback dives.

Anyway, this is where you all come in. We need people to submit proposals with any pictures, profit margins, sponsorships, bonus amenities, special features, and fan engagement opportunities that you can gather. After we have all of the submissions collected by the due date of Sunday July 23, 2023 at 11:59pm ET, the admins and staff will work together to vote and select the best proposal.

Please reply below here with your highest and best proposal for us to consider! Thank you very much.
